Maharampura is a village situated in Gwalior tehsil of Gwalior district in Madhya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 128 families residing in the village Maharampura. The total population of Maharampura is 534 out of which 312 are males and 222 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Maharampura is 712.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Maharampura village is 64 which is 12% of the total population. There are 39 male children and 25 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Maharampura is 641 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(712) of Maharampura village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Maharampura is 64.3%. Thus Maharampura village has a lower literacy rate compared to 66.8% of Gwalior district. The male literacy rate is 80.59% and the female literacy rate is 41.62% in Maharampura village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 9.6%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 12.9% of total population in Maharampura village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Maharampura village out of total population, 187 were engaged in work activities. 97.3%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 2.7%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 187 workers engaged in Main Work, 91 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 69 were Agricultural labourers.
